P0A69

Drive Motor B Phase V Current

P0A69 is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Drive Motor B Phase V Current. Common causes: phase v current sensor fault, damage to wiring or connectors. Estimated repair cost: $56โ€“278.

Severity
๐Ÿ”ด High
Can you drive?
Do not drive โ€” repair immediately
Approx. repair cost
$56โ€“278 (est.)

Symptoms

  • Hybrid system power reduction
  • Increased fuel consumption
  • Check Engine Light Illuminates
  • Unstable operation of the electric motor
  • The vehicle goes into emergency mode

Causes

  • Phase V current sensor fault
  • Damage to wiring or connectors
  • Short circuit in the circuit
  • Problems with the hybrid system control unit
  • Contact corrosion

How to Fix

  1. Check the integrity of wiring and connectors
  2. Test current sensors
  3. Check circuit resistance
  4. Diagnose the hybrid system control unit
  5. Replace faulty components
